Town of Charlton
MINUTES, Public Hearing to hear input on the Tentative 2004 Town Budget held at 7:00 P.M. on Monday, October 27, 2003 at the Town Hall.

The meeting was called to order by Supervisor Acunto.

Supervisor Acunto – A handout has been made available to everyone. The total budget for Highway and General is a total of $1,700,295.00. It is approximately a 5.9 % increase over last year’s budget. There is basically a 4 % across the board increase in most of the areas with substantial increases in health insurance, which is approximately a 12 % increase and a NYS retirement increase that we calculated at approximately 54.8 %. In addition to that, we have received notification that our liability insurance could possibly have an increase of 10 % or more. By law, our insurance carrier must notify us if there is a possibility of an increase of over 10%. They have put us on notice that it will be over 10 %. Within the budget itself there is an increase in roadwork of $20,000.00. There is an added increase of $5,000.00 regarding storm drainage management. We have put in an ad valorem increase from Glenville. They have said we can anticipate somewhere around 2 ˝ times what the ad valorem is right now. Basically, that is an executive summary of the budget.
